What are the benefits of ozone sterilisation?
Ozone sterilisation is a process used to destroy microorganisms andeliminate odours in a variety of applications using ozone gas. Ozone isastrong oxidiser and can clean and deodorise items and areaswell.Ozone sterilisation has attracted much attention in recent years dueto its many advantages over traditional sterilisation methods. In thisarticle we will look in depth at the many benefits of ozone sterilisation.
Advantage 1: Efficiency
One of the main advantages of ozone sterilisation is the ability to kill awide range of microorganisms. Ozone is a very active gas that can killbacteria, viruses, fungi and other harmful pathogens.Chemicaldisinfectants can be ineffective against certain microorganismsOzone is effectiveagainst a variety of contaminants It is particularlyeffective at killing tough bacteria such as methicillin-resistantStaphylococcus aureus (MRSA) and Clostridium difficile (C. diff) whichmay be resistant to othersterilisation techniques.
Advantage 2: Fast Responses
Ozone sterilisation is rapid and effective. Ozone gas penetrates porousmaterials, fabrics and inaccessible places to achieve completedisinfection. Ozone destroys microorganisms by oxidising their cell walls,proteins and enzymes when they are in contact. The process normallytakes a few minutes/hours, depending on the size and complexity of thesterilisation area. Ozonesterilisation is faster than heat or chemicalsterilisation methods that may require longer exposure times making itwell suited for time-sensitive applications.

Advantage 4: Odour removed
Ozone is also an excellent odour eliminator as well as asteriliser. Ozonemolecules eliminate and break down odor-causing compounds leavingthe air smelling clean and fresh. This property of ozonesterilisation isparticularly advantageous in those environments where the problem ofunpleasant odours is substantial such as hospitals, food processingplants and wastewater treatment plants. Ozone is very effective atremoving odours such as smoke odours, mould odours, pet odours andvolatile organic compounds (VOCs).
